What Are The Long-term Effects Of The Keto Diet?

The long-term effects of the keto diet are not yet known.
When people think of the keto diet, they often think of it as a quick way to lose weight. And while it can certainly help you drop pounds quickly, there are some potential long-term effects of the keto diet that you should be aware of before you start.

First, a keto diet can lower your levels of HDL (good) cholesterol and raise your levels of LDL (bad) cholesterol. This can increase your risk for heart disease and stroke.

Second, a keto diet can lead to kidney stones and other kidney problems. This is because the diet causes your body to excrete more calcium than it normally would.

Third, a keto diet can cause muscle loss. This is because when your body is in ketosis, it breaks down muscle for energy.

Fourth, a keto diet can cause gastrointestinal issues like constipation and diarrhea. This is because the diet is low in fiber and can cause your digestive system to slow down.

Finally, a keto diet can increase your risk for some types of cancer. This is because the diet can alter the way your body metabolizes certain hormones and growth factors.

So, while a keto diet can help you lose weight quickly, there are some potential long-term effects that you should be aware of. If you have any concerns about these effects, be sure to speak with your doctor before starting the diet.

Is The Keto Diet Safe For Children?

The keto diet is not recommended for children unless they are under the care of a medical professional. The diet is very high in fat and low in carbohydrates, which can lead to problems such as gastrointestinal distress, increased risk of dehydration, and constipation.
